Overview

Food packaging capping machines are specialized equipment designed to automate the sealing process of containers in food and beverage production lines. They handle various cap types, including screw caps, snap-on lids, and press-on seals, ensuring airtight and tamper-evident packaging. These machines are critical for maintaining product freshness and compliance with hygiene regulations. Modern cappers integrate with filling and labeling systems to form complete packaging lines. They are widely used in industries such as dairy, sauces, juices, and pharmaceuticals, where precision and speed are paramount. The machines reduce labor costs and minimize human contact with products, enhancing food safety.

Structure and Working Principle

A typical capping machine consists of a cap hopper, sorting mechanism, conveyor belt, and capping head. The hopper feeds caps into a sorting system that orients them correctly before transfer to the capping station. Containers move via conveyor under the capping head, which applies and tightens the cap with controlled torque. Advanced models use servo motors for precise torque adjustment, preventing over-tightening or leaks. Some machines incorporate vision systems to detect misaligned caps or defective seals. The modular design allows customization for different container sizes and cap styles, such as flip-tops or child-resistant closures.

Key Features

High-speed cappers can process over 600 containers per minute, with adjustable settings for varying production needs. They often include touchscreen interfaces for easy operation and real-time monitoring of torque, speed, and error rates. Food-grade materials like stainless steel (304 or 316) ensure durability and compliance with sanitation requirements. Many machines support Clean-in-Place (CIP) systems, reducing downtime for cleaning. Anti-jamming mechanisms and automatic cap rejection for defects further enhance efficiency. Energy-efficient designs with low noise output are increasingly common in eco-conscious facilities.

Application Areas

Capping machines are indispensable in the food and beverage sector, particularly for bottled water, carbonated drinks, edible oils, and condiments. They are also used in pharmaceutical and cosmetic industries for sealing medicine bottles or lotion containers. Dairy plants rely on cappers for milk and yogurt products, while breweries use them for beer bottles with crown caps. The machines adapt to glass, PET, or metal containers, making them versatile for diverse packaging formats. Specialized models handle unique requirements, such as nitrogen flushing for oxygen-sensitive products.

Maintenance and Precautions

Regular maintenance includes lubricating moving parts, inspecting belts for wear, and calibrating torque sensors. Daily cleaning with food-safe detergents prevents bacterial buildup, especially in wet environments. Operators should check cap feeders for blockages and ensure alignment tools are free of debris. Safety precautions include emergency stop buttons and protective guards to prevent operator injuries. Scheduled downtime for deep cleaning and part replacement (e.g., grippers, springs) extends machine lifespan. Logging performance data helps identify trends like increasing torque deviations, indicating potential issues.

B2B Procurement Guide

When selecting a capping machine, prioritize suppliers with experience in your specific product category (e.g., viscous liquids vs. dry goods). Request demonstrations with your actual containers and caps to test compatibility. Key metrics include changeover time between cap types and Mean Time Between Failures (MTBF). Verify certifications like CE, FDA, or ISO 22000 for food safety. Total cost of ownership (TCO) should factor in energy consumption, spare part availability, and after-sales support. Leasing options or modular upgrades may be cost-effective for small-to-mid-scale producers.
